Handover note — Crumbwheel order cutoffs.

Welcome aboard. The bakery cutoff rule in Crumbwheel closes same-day orders at 14:00 local to each storefront, not UTC — this has bitten us twice. Holiday overrides live in the calendar service and take precedence silently, so always check there first when a cutoff looks wrong. To unlock the calendar service's admin console after a restart, enter the recovery passphrase below.

vault phrase of bagap-bahaf = silion-pelox-sorox-casdor-quenwyn-fraax-eliox-praael-kelion-quenvan-kasox-rusael-norius-belvan

**Ticket: Config drift in WaveGlimpse preview renderer**

Production and staging have diverged for the audio waveform preview service: staging renders at higher resolution and uses a different peak-sampling window, so QA sign-offs no longer reflect production behavior. Requesting a freeze on manual edits until we reconcile. For reference, production currently holds these values.

config for bawig-fadup:
[zorix]
host = zorix.lumicworks.corp
user = zorix_svc
database = zorix_prod

## Runbook: Spreadsheet Export Memory Spikes

When the Corvette export worker in Ledgermill exceeds 6 GB resident memory, it is almost always a tenant requesting a full-history spreadsheet export. First, check the export queue depth on the Harborview dashboard, then enable streaming mode for the offending tenant, which chunks rows instead of buffering the workbook. If the worker must be drained, call the internal Drainpipe admin endpoint directly. For the sync notes: the endpoint authenticates with the key below.

gateway credential: zpat3_i6x